2 Killed, Dog Injured After Small Plane Crashes Near Colusa

COLUSA, Calif. (AP) – Authorities in Colusa County say two men were killed when a small plane they were in crashed into a pond in a rural area. The Colusa County Sheriff’s office said Tuesday deputies found the bodies of 66-year-old Jeffrey Webber, of Healdsburg, and 71-year-old Lionel Robin, of Arnaudville, Louisiana, in the plane’s wreckage. The office says the deputies responded to the scene after receiving a report from federal aviation officials that a private small plane carrying two passengers and a dog had crashed Monday about 2 { miles south of Colusa. Deputies also found a badly injured dog in a nearby roadway. The office says the Federal Aviation Administration and National Traffic Safety Board are investigating what caused of the plane to crash.
